Throughout it's long history, the OpenVMS operating system has established a 
solid reputation for reliability, resiliency and high performance. 
Consequently, it has a passionate core group of users who have remained 
committed to OpenVMS through the succession of several parent companies: 
Digital Equipment, Compaq, and currently Hewlett Packard. HP has refreshed 
their commitment to invest in OpenVMS development and maintain it on the latest 
HP processors. There is every reason to expect their users will continue to 
rely upon OpenVMS for years to come.

For many years enterprise customers have used EMC NetWorker to protect OpenVMS 
platforms and the Oracle-based applications that run on them. The NetWorker 
team is in the process of refreshing it's support for OpenVMS by updating the 
NetWorker software used to protect OpenVMS systems to version 8.0. This 
refreshed support means that NetWorker users in healthcare, government and 
other vertical markets can upgrade their entire NetWorker environment to the 
most current versions and continue to protect the OpenVMS platforms used for 
business critical applications. 

The NetWorker team is looking for NetWorker users who can be candidates to 
participate in a testing program for NetWorker 8.0 on OpenVMS systems. Testing 
is expected to commence in October, 2013.

Candidate customers will have met the following two requirements:

* Upgraded their NetWorker server version to 7.6 or 8.0.  
* Using NetWorker to protect OpenVMS clients running on Alpha and/or Integrity 
systems

Optionally, candidates may also meet one or more of the following:

* An OpenVMS platform in a test environment
* Using Storage nodes on an OpenVMS platform driving I/O to a backup device 
(either dedicated and/or remote storage nodes qualify)
* Using the NetWorker client to protect classic Oracle and/or Oracle Rdb data 
bases.

A partial list of new features in NetWorker 8.0 that are now supported with 
OpenVMS clients include:

* Client Direct to AFTD, including Data Domain via NFS/CIFS
* Multi-pathing for AFTDs
* Generation of RMAN scripts for Oracle backups

Note: Support for OpenVMS on VAX systems has transitioned into end of life and 
VAX systems are excluded from this test.
